Common Walkway Repair Jobs
Concrete walkway repair - restores uneven or cracked surfaces for safe walking.
Paver walkway restoration - replaces or realigns pavers to improve appearance and stability.
Crack filling and sealing - prevents further damage by sealing small cracks and gaps.
Surface leveling - corrects uneven sections for a smooth, safe walking path.
Joint and edge repair - reinforces edges to prevent crumbling and maintain walkway integrity.
Complete walkway replacement - replaces deteriorated walkways to ensure durability and safety.
Walkway Repair Questions
What types of walkway damage require repair? Common issues include cracks, uneven surfaces, and loose or broken pavers that can pose safety hazards and affect appearance.
How can I tell if my walkway needs repair? Visible cracks, shifting, or deterioration of the surface are signs that maintenance or repair may be necessary.
What materials are used for walkway repairs? Repairs often involve concrete, pavers, or flagstone, depending on the existing material and the project’s needs.
Are walkway repairs suitable for all property types? Yes, repairs can be tailored to residential driveways, patios, or commercial walkways to improve safety and aesthetics.
